A network of underground gas stations exposed in Odesa region

(An underground gas station. PHOTO: TU BEB in Odesa region)

A case against a resident of the Berezivska community who organized an illegal network of gas stations has been brought to court in Odesa. Law enforcement officers seized more than 33 thousand liters of counterfeit fuel worth more than UAH 3 million.

This was reported by the press service of the Bureau of Economic Security in Odesa region.

The Bureau of Economic Security of Ukraine has completed an investigation and submitted an indictment to the court against a 27-year-old resident of the Berezivska community who organized an illegal network of gas stations in Odesa region. According to the investigation, the man was not registered as an entrepreneur, but for more than a year he had been running an illegal fuel sales business.

He bought gasoline and diesel fuel of dubious origin from another person involved in the criminal proceedings at low prices and then sold it at gas stations in Berezivka and Dobroslav without any permits.

To systematize his work, the entrepreneur used special software to control, account for and sell illegal fuel. He hired two people to operate the gas stations and sell gasoline and diesel directly to customers. The employees were paid unofficially in cash "in envelopes".

Law enforcement officers conducted a series of searches at the illegal gas stations. As a result, more than 33,000 liters of A-95 gasoline and diesel fuel, equipment for the operation of gas stations, 16 large containers for storing fuels and lubricants, draft records and cash were seized. The total value of the seized property and fuel is estimated at UAH 3.4 million.

The collected evidence allowed to serve the man a notice of suspicion of committing a criminal offense stipulated by Part 1 Art. 204 of the Criminal Code of Ukraine - illegal manufacture, storage and sale of excisable goods. The indictment has already been sent to court.

The law provides for punishment for the committed offense in the form of a significant fine with mandatory confiscation and destruction of illegally manufactured goods.

In addition, a resident of Bilhorod-Dnistrovskyi district was buying gasoline and diesel of unknown origin at low prices during 2024 without having a license or registering as an entrepreneur. To establish sales, he set up illegal gas stations in trucks and non-residential premises, through which he sold fuel in Tatarbunary and Spaske villages.
